Soccer Preview: Carl Junction vs. Monett
Carl Junction is 1-8 against Monett since September of 2015 but they'll have a chance to close the gap a little bit on Tuesday. The Bulldogs will host the Cubs at 6:30 p.m. Expect the scorekeeper to be kept busy: if their previous games are any indication, these teams will really light up the scoreboard.
Monett better have a healthy lead at halftime, because if Carl Junction's game on Tuesday is any indication, that's when Carl Junction really gets things going. The Bulldogs' defense stepped up to hand Marshfield a 4-0 shutout. The result was nothing new for Carl Junction, who have now won five matchups by three goals or more so far this season.
Nolan Couk and Ryan Landolt scored all four of Carl Junction's goals, bringing their combined season tally to 22 goals.
Meanwhile, Monett's game on Tuesday was all tied up 1-1 at the half, but luckily for them it didn't stay that way. They narrowly escaped with a win as the squad sidled past McDonald County 4-3. The high-scoring performance was a welcome turnaround for Monett's offense, which had struggled in the games prior.
Monett is on a roll lately: they've won ten of their last 12 contests. That's provided a nice bump to their 12-4 record this season. Those victories came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they scored 41 goals over those 12 matches. As for Carl Junction, their win bumped their record up to 9-6.
